Anutin Charnvirakul said Thailand accused Cambodian forces of firing thousands of rockets and using airstrikes and drones along the long-smoldering border, prompting mass evacuations and at least twenty-five deaths, and reporters described the body of Don Patchapan after a rocket struck a residential area near a school.Surasant Kongsiri said fighting has been continuous since the ceasefire was paused, and Thai officials warned that Cambodia deployed truck-mounted BM-21 rocket launchers with thirty to forty kilometre ranges capable of firing large salvos, while the Cambodian Defence Ministry denied responsibility and blamed Thailand for strikes.Hun Manet posted a morale-boosting message as
